Security House Factory Lane Business Park, Penwortham, Preston, Lancashire, United Kingdom, PR1 9TD
One, Central Quay, Glasgow, Scotland, G3 8DA
Popular Companies
Latest Companies
Copyright © 2024. All rights reserved.